105 /*
106  * Interface flags that can be set in an ifconfig command.
107  *
108  * Setting link0 will make the link passive, i.e. it will be marked
109  * as being administrative openable, but won't be opened to begin
110  * with.  Incoming calls will be answered, or subsequent calls with
111  * -link1 will cause the administrative open of the LCP layer.
112  *
113  * Setting link1 will cause the link to auto-dial only as packets
114  * arrive to be sent.
115  *
116  * Setting IFF_DEBUG will syslog the option negotiation and state
117  * transitions at level kern.debug.  Note: all logs consistently look
118  * like
119  *
120  *   <if-name><unit>: <proto-name> <additional info...>
121  *
122  * with <if-name><unit> being something like "bppp0", and <proto-name>
123  * being one of "lcp", "ipcp", "cisco", "chap", "pap", etc.

3910
3911 /*
3912  * The authentication protocols don't employ a full-fledged state machine as
3913  * the control protocols do, since they do have Open and Close events, but
3914  * not Up and Down, nor are they explicitly terminated.  Also, use of the
3915  * authentication protocols may be different in both directions (this makes
3916  * sense, think of a machine that never accepts incoming calls but only
3917  * calls out, it doesn't require the called party to authenticate itself).
3918  *
3919  * Our state machine for the local authentication protocol (we are requesting
3920  * the peer to authenticate) looks like:
3921  *
3922  *                                                  RCA-
3923  *            +--------------------------------------------+
3924  *            V                                     scn,tld|
3925  *        +--------+                           Close   +---------+ RCA+
3926  *        |        |<----------------------------------|         |------+
3927  *   +--->| Closed |                            TO*    | Opened  | sca  |
3928  *   |    |        |-----+                     +-------|         |<-----+
3929  *   |    +--------+ irc |                     |       +---------+
3930  *   |      ^            |                     |           ^
3931  *   |      |            |                     |           |
3932  *   |      |            |                     |           |
3933  *   |   TO-|            |                     |           |
3934  *   |      |tld  TO+    V                     |           |
3935  *   |      |   +------->+                     |           |
3936  *   |      |   |        |                     |           |
3937  *   |    +--------+     V                     |           |
3938  *   |    |        |<----+<--------------------+           |
3939  *   |    | Req-   | scr                                   |
3940  *   |    | Sent   |                                       |
3941  *   |    |        |                                       |
3942  *   |    +--------+                                       |
3943  *   | RCA- |   | RCA+                                     |
3944  *   +------+   +------------------------------------------+
3945  *   scn,tld      sca,irc,ict,tlu
3946  *
3947  *
3948  *   with:
3949  *
3950  *      Open:   LCP reached authentication phase
3951  *      Close:  LCP reached terminate phase
3952  *
3953  *      RCA+:   received reply (pap-req, chap-response), acceptable
3954  *      RCN:    received reply (pap-req, chap-response), not acceptable
3955  *      TO+:    timeout with restart counter >= 0
3956  *      TO-:    timeout with restart counter < 0
3957  *      TO*:    reschedule timeout for CHAP
3958  *
3959  *      scr:    send request packet (none for PAP, chap-challenge)
3960  *      sca:    send ack packet (pap-ack, chap-success)
3961  *      scn:    send nak packet (pap-nak, chap-failure)
3962  *      ict:    initialize re-challenge timer (CHAP only)
3963  *
3964  *      tlu:    this-layer-up, LCP reaches network phase
3965  *      tld:    this-layer-down, LCP enters terminate phase
3966  *
3967  * Note that in CHAP mode, after sending a new challenge, while the state
3968  * automaton falls back into Req-Sent state, it doesn't signal a tld
3969  * event to LCP, so LCP remains in network phase.  Only after not getting
3970  * any response (or after getting an unacceptable response), CHAP closes,
3971  * causing LCP to enter terminate phase.
3972  *
3973  * With PAP, there is no initial request that can be sent.  The peer is
3974  * expected to send one based on the successful negotiation of PAP as
3975  * the authentication protocol during the LCP option negotiation.
3976  *
3977  * Incoming authentication protocol requests (remote requests
3978  * authentication, we are peer) don't employ a state machine at all,
3979  * they are simply answered.  Some peers [Ascend P50 firmware rev
3980  * 4.50] react allergically when sending IPCP requests while they are
3981  * still in authentication phase (thereby violating the standard that
3982  * demands that these NCP packets are to be discarded), so we keep
3983  * track of the peer demanding us to authenticate, and only proceed to
3984  * phase network once we've seen a positive acknowledge for the
3985  * authentication.
